Quantum states 1,000,000 passes for SDLT and DLT IV, and 500,000 for DLT 
III

http://www.quantum.com/Products/DLTtape+Drives+and+Media/Tape+Media/Default.htm

click on Super "DLTtape Media Data Sheet" and "Super DLTtape Media Data
Sheet" on the right, under Tape Media Marketing and News.

This is of course, not uses, or mounts, but I will not be throwing away
SDLT tapes here after only 100 mounts.  OTOH, our daily tapes, which each
are used once per week, will see only 150 mounts.  This is assuming a
three year technology refresh cycle.  The weekly tapes, used once per
quarter, should last much longer than we require.

I have heard no recommendations from anywhere else.  Feel free to let me 
know if I'm way off base.

On Wed, 17 Jul 2002, Fabbro, Andrew P wrote:

> Max mount of 50,000 for DLT?!? 
> <clutches his chest>  Oh, 'lizabeth, this is the big one!  Oh!
>  
> The suggestion I've heard time and again is 100 max mounts, based on
> "full-length writes".  I've used 125 (assuming that some of my writes
> are not full-length) for DLT-7000 and was feeling racy.  Even some of
> the newer hardcore, macho-enterprise-man stuff (e.g., STK 9940) is not
> rated for 50,000 mounts.
>  
> I've long suspected that the suggestion of 100 mounts was way on the
> conservative side.  But the value of the data is usually infinite
> compared to the cost of the media, and I don't want to be the one who
> says "yeah, I saved us fifty bucks on buying tapes but I lost your
> database, mister vice president".
